The simple way to stop putting on weight and hopefully lose it is to cut down how much we eat, here are some tips to help you out:
Waste some of your food: Most of us pile far too much food onto our plates and that is a hard habit to break because we think we will go hungry if we cut back, so until you do learn to put less on your plate then you are going to have to waste some. There is no perfect amount to throw away so I would start off with something like a quarter of your meal, be strong and throw it away before you have taken a bite of it.
We get a lot of satisfaction from eating our entire meal, often we have been brought up not to waste food so it is ingrained into us. That is why it is important you throw the food away before you start so you still get to clear your plate, but you are eating fewer calories. Once you realize that throwing that amount away doesn’t affect how hungry you are then you can start working out how to order 25% less food, or put less on your plate anyway, and your portion size will gradually shrink.
Never go shopping when you are hungry: If you go shopping when you are hungry I can guarantee you that you will come back with a lot of stuff that you don’t need or want, and then feel obligated to eat it as you bought it. Instead what you need to do is wait until you have had your dinner and then go straight after that, suddenly you won’t want anything other than items on your shopping list. That way not only are you going to be eating less junk but you’ll also be saving money!
